Luminaries Light Trails at Lebanon Hills New Year's Eve Party

The Eagan Community Center is also hosting a New Year's Eve party on Tuesday.

Dakota County Parks is hosting its 8th annual New Year's Eve party at the Lebanon Hills Visitor's Center in Eagan.

The event will run from 5 p.m. to 8 p.m. on Dec. 31. Some of the activities planned include snowshoeing, sledding, ice skating, live animals, bonfires and a ball drop. 

Admission is $8 per person if purchased early and $10 at the door. Children ages 5 years and under can attend for free. 

Visitors should bring their own sleds, ice skates and snowshoes; however, snowshoe rental is available for a fee. 

Park for free at Woodcrest Church, located at 525 Cliff Road. A free shuttle will transport visitors to and from the event.

Also on Tuesday:

The Eagan Community Center is also hosting a New Year's Eve party. The free event runs from 5 p.m. to 9 p.m. and includes various activities, such as games, crafts, Blast admission and a ball drop.
